Abstract:

In the present contribution the development of an innovative structural system for short span roadbridges is presented. In particular, the use of prestressed concrete tension ties is shown to offer new possibilities for the conception and design of bridge structures. Aesthetics as well as structural efficiency are discussed. Transparency and structural simplicity are characteristics that contribute to a clear appearance. The reduction of dead load while maintaining sufficient stiffness is a general optimization task in structural engineering; it is shown that by choosing suitable dimensions and materials and an appropriate level of prestress convincing solutions can be achieved.
